Fuel-air explosive


  • Fuel bomb

Nature

The warhead contains fuel that is dispersed into the air by an initial explosion. A second explosion ignites the mixture of air and fuel, creating a fireball and shock wave. It can be 10 times more powerful than conventional explosives of the same size.
